I have a 1980 CJ7 258 auto. My Frankinjeep's previous owner put a painless wiring harness. I wanted to remove it and replace it with a factory harness. On two different occasions I removed the painless harness to do major work on the tub, but ultimately I put the painless harness back in because it really was far superior to the factory harness. My only issue is despite a new neutral safety switch it will still start in drive and reverse
As it turned out the neutral safety switch issue was because PO put the wrong solenoid in. It needed an solenoid for an automatic transmission and PO put a solenoid for a standard transmission. There is a difference, and to be fair I didn't know either until I did the research. I changed the solenoid and it worked.

They all work the same, just make sure the wiring is GXL wire. As for cost, EZwiring is by far the less of them all, they just don't have a bunch of "custom" kits. Their 21 circuit will fit just any vehicle out there and give you room to expand.
